Mani Mazinani

Toronto-based artist

Mani Mazinani (b.1984, Tehran) is a Toronto-based artist making installation, video, film, sculpture, photographs, multiples, sound, and music. His practice evolved from an early interest in sound recording, now working with the process of translating thoughts into recordings in various media. His visual work thinks about scale and perception, often combining subject matter and medium. Mazinani is currently researching origins of ancient thought, perceptual limitations of humans, and improvisation. Currently, he is developing the Solar Organ in the Connected Minds artist residency at York University (2026). Exhibition and performance history includes Evergreen Brick Works (2024), MOCA Toronto (2024), Tate Modern (2019), The Bentway, Toronto (2018), Tehran International Electronic Music Festival (2017), SIP Culture Centre, Suzhou (2016).

Visiting the Birdhouse was a wonderful experience. The welcoming warmth of Charles and his family is coupled with extraordinary access to beautiful nature-scapes, from the amazing arbutus trees at their doorstep to the selection of lakes that we swam in while surrounded by forests. East Sooke Regional Park is a short drive away for an awesome coastal hike and beautiful vistas overlooking the Salish Sea. The Birdhouse itself was really fun to stay in. The spacious open concept layout is both clarifying and comfortable, with modern and sleek bathroom and kitchen. It the perfect place for some concentration, creativity and to take a nice deep breath.
